Original Description
Fanny Churberg’s Moonlight, study is a captivating example of 19th-century Finnish Romantic painting, showcasing her mastery of mood and light. The artwork immerses viewers in a serene nocturnal landscape, where the soft glow of moonlight bathes the scene in silvery hues, evoking a sense of quiet mystique. Painted during Finland’s national awakening, Churberg’s work reflects the era’s fascination with nature and emotional depth. Her loose, expressive brushstrokes and emphasis on atmospheric effects align her with the Düsseldorf School, though her unique use of color and texture sets her apart. As one of Finland’s few prominent female artists of her time, Churberg’s contributions are significant in Nordic art history, bridging Romanticism and the emerging Symbolist movement. Moonlight, study remains celebrated for its evocative tranquility and technical brilliance.
